China News Service, Qinzhou, Guangxi, September 16 (Reporter Yang Chen) The Pinglu Canal, the backbone project of the New Land-Sea Corridor in Western China, was completed and opened to navigation on the 16th, opening up a major channel to the sea with the shortest distance, the most economical and most convenient transportation distance from southwestern China to ASEAN.
Construction of the Pinglu Canal started on August 28, 2022, with a total investment of approximately 72.7 billion yuan (the same below) and a total length of 134.2 kilometers. It starts from the mouth of the Pingtang River in Xijin Reservoir Area, Hengzhou City, Nanning in the north, passes through Luwu Town, Lingshan County, Qinzhou in the south, and leads directly to the Beibu Gulf along the Qin River.
On September 16, the Pinglu Canal opening ceremony was held at the Pinglu Canal Horse Road Junction in Qinzhou, Guangxi. Photo by China News Service reporter Yang Chen
This canal, which has the highest level of navigation in China, was built according to the Class I standard for inland rivers and can be navigable for 5,000-ton ships. Three major cascade hubs, including Horse Road, Qishi and Youth, have been built across the entire line. The project has created four "best in the world": the world's strongest canal navigation capacity, the world's fastest ship lock navigation speed, the world's highest water-saving lock drop, and the world's largest inland water-saving lock.
After the Pinglu Canal is opened to navigation, goods from southwest China can go to sea through the canal, shortening the inland voyage by more than 560 kilometers compared with traditional routes. The voyage to major ASEAN ports is significantly shortened, and comprehensive logistics costs are reduced by 18% to 30%. It can save society more than 5 billion yuan in transportation costs every year.

"This canal is not only a logistics channel, but may also become a lever to connect the industrial chains between western China and ASEAN, transforming geographical 'proximity' into 'closeness' of industrial cooperation, and promoting both parties from commodity exchange to nested cooperation in the upstream and downstream of the industrial chain." said Yu Hong, a senior researcher at the Institute of East Asian Studies at the National University of Singapore.
The navigation ceremony was held at the Pinglu Canal Horse Road Hub in Qinzhou, and four linkage scenes were set up in Nanning Port, Qinzhou Port, Xinfu Water Comprehensive Service Area, and Qinzhou Water Comprehensive Service Area, and the four water passenger routes were opened simultaneously. China State Railway Group Co., Ltd. reported on the 16th that from January to August, national railways completed fixed asset investment of 511.8 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 1.5%. A number of high-speed rail projects are progressing smoothly, and railway investment continues to drive industrial development and employment, providing new momentum for expanding domestic demand and stabilizing growth.
As the first inland open port in Jiangxi, Ganzhou International Dry Port has operated more than 25,000 trains, and the number of China-Europe (Asia) trains has exceeded 1,800. It promotes the export of furniture, home appliances and other products in the old areas of southern Gansu. It also facilitates the entry of global goods into the local area. The timeliness of timber imports has been increased by about 20%, and logistics costs have been reduced by nearly 30%.

The Kaohsiung Metropolitan Development Bureau announced the results of the public urban renewal selection for the A6 street east of the MRT R17 World Transport Station. A cooperative alliance led by Yingshun Construction and Xingxing Chang Steel was selected as the best applicant, with a total investment of more than 7.2 billion yuan. This project will build 4 buildings, of which the city government will allocate a 17-story complex building, which combines talent residences, A-level commercial offices, commercial facilities and public childcare. The remaining three buildings will be 21-story residential and commercial facilities. A three-dimensional sky bridge will be planned to connect the A5 street profile directly to the World Games Station, and implement barrier-free, earthquake-resistant, green building and smart building labels.
